1 week volunteer abroad programs in Africa

Even with just seven days available, you can enjoy a life-changing experience in Africa. Our short volunteer opportunities are ideal for those seeking to immerse themselves in conservation while balancing other commitments like family, study, or work. Each African Conservation Experience is customised to ensure your short-term contribution supports long-term conservation goals.

For example, our wildlife rehabilitation experiences enable you to work directly and help care for injured and orphaned animals. Your support can significantly improve the welfare and recovery of each animal, assisting with essential daily routines like preparing food, cleaning enclosures, monitoring health, and providing enrichment. For an animal in recovery, those seven days of consistent, compassionate care can be the difference between stress and stability.

Or, you might assist with vital field research that benefits species such as rhinos or elephants. Every day in the field is a chance to learn and contribute. Data collection is constantly ongoing and is time-sensitive - every set of tracks and observation made feeds into the bigger conservation picture and reserve management decisions. With your involvement, even on a 1 week volunteer abroad program, more ground can be covered.

2 week volunteer abroad programs in Africa

If you have more flexibility with your time, volunteering abroad for 2 weeks offers a deeper dive into Africa's remarkable wildlife and landscapes. With a little more time, you can build stronger relationships with local teams and further develop your understanding of conservation in action.

At an animal rehabilitation centre, you'll start to observe the real progress in the animals you're helping to care for, making your experience more rewarding and insightful. The longer you're there, the more you'll understand the individual needs of the animals, and the more meaningful your critical contribution becomes.

In a research setting, with repeated exposure to fieldwork, you'll gain even more confidence in your practical conservation skills. Your understanding will deepen, transforming your experience from simply helping to truly learning. The additional time also gives you a richer appreciation for the long-term goals of the project, and the role that a 2 week volunteer abroad program plays in achieving them.

Will I make an impact through short term volunteering?

Absolutely! Especially when volunteering with organisations that prioritise ethical, well-planned experiences, integrating you into real, ongoing conservation efforts.

We only partner with wildlife research projects in Africa that either support fully self-sustaining animal populations or follow an "assisted sustainable" model, where minimal human intervention supports long-term viability. All our partner animal rehabilitation centres strictly follow the animal welfare standards set by SATSA and ABTA, ensuring that animals live as naturally as possible while receiving the highest standards of care, ethical treatment, and conservation value. Both types of work align with the UN Sustainable Development Goals, and we are also proud to be affiliated with leading global organisations like WWF and the Endangered Wildlife Trust (EWT).
